Frequently Asked Questions About Assisted Living in Maxwell

Common questions families have when exploring assisted living options in Maxwell, Nebraska.

What is the average monthly cost for assisted living in Maxwell, Nebraska?

In Maxwell, Nebraska, the average monthly cost for assisted living typically ranges from $3,500 to $5,000, depending on the level of care, room type, and amenities. This is generally lower than the national average, making Maxwell an affordable option for seniors in the region. It's best to contact local facilities directly for specific pricing and any available financial assistance programs.

Are there any assisted living facilities located directly in Maxwell, NE?

Maxwell is a small village in Lincoln County, Nebraska, and may have limited dedicated assisted living facilities within its immediate boundaries. However, residents often access nearby options in larger communities like North Platte, which is approximately 15 miles away and offers several licensed assisted living facilities. It's advisable to check with local senior services or the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services for the most current listings.

What types of care and services are typically offered by assisted living facilities serving Maxwell residents?

Assisted living facilities serving the Maxwell area typically provide services such as medication management, personal care assistance, meal preparation, housekeeping, and social activities. Many also offer specialized memory care for residents with dementia. Since Maxwell is a rural community, some facilities may coordinate with local healthcare providers in North Platte for additional medical services, ensuring residents receive comprehensive care close to home.

How are assisted living facilities regulated in Nebraska, and what should I look for when choosing one near Maxwell?

Assisted living facilities in Nebraska are regulated by the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services, which ensures compliance with state licensing standards for safety, staffing, and care. When choosing a facility near Maxwell, look for proper licensing, recent inspection reports, staff qualifications, and resident reviews. It's also helpful to visit facilities in person and ask about their emergency procedures, especially given the rural setting of Maxwell and potential weather-related challenges.

What local resources in Maxwell or Lincoln County can help seniors and families with assisted living decisions?

Seniors and families in Maxwell can turn to resources like the Lincoln County Area Agency on Aging, which provides information on assisted living options, financial assistance, and caregiver support. Additionally, local senior centers and healthcare providers in North Platte often offer guidance and referrals. Connecting with these resources can help navigate available services and support networks specific to the Maxwell and greater Lincoln County area.

Finding Quality Long-Term Care Facilities in Maxwell, Nebraska

When you begin searching for long term care facilities near you in Maxwell, Nebraska, it often comes at a time of significant transition for your family. The wide-open skies and tight-knit community of Maxwell mean you’re likely looking not just for a facility, but for a caring home that respects the values of rural Nebraska living. This process, while daunting, is a profound act of love, and taking a thoughtful, step-by-step approach can help you find the right fit for your loved one’s next chapter.

Start by understanding the types of care available. In our area, you’ll primarily find skilled nursing facilities, which provide 24-hour medical care and rehabilitation, and assisted living communities, which offer more independence with support for daily activities. Some facilities may offer a continuum of care, allowing residents to transition between levels of support as their needs change. Given the distances between towns in Lincoln County, considering proximity is crucial, but also think about where your loved one’s existing social connections and healthcare providers are located.

We recommend making a list of priorities specific to your family’s situation. Beyond medical needs, consider what daily life should feel like. Does your loved one thrive on quiet, or enjoy organized activities? For a lifelong Nebraskan, access to a secure outdoor space to enjoy the changing seasons or a common area where they can share stories with neighbors from similar backgrounds can be deeply important. Don’t hesitate to ask facilities about how they celebrate local traditions or facilitate visits from community groups, as this connection to Maxwell can ease the transition.

The most critical step is the in-person visit. Schedule tours at a few facilities you’ve identified through online research, recommendations from local healthcare providers in North Platte, or word-of-mouth in the Maxwell community. Go beyond the scheduled tour; visit at different times of the day, such as during a meal or an activity session. Observe the interactions between staff and residents. Do they speak with kindness and respect? Is the atmosphere calm and welcoming? Trust your instincts—the feeling you get when you walk in the door is often very telling.

Prepare a list of questions for each visit. Ask about staff-to-resident ratios, the training and longevity of the care team, and how they handle medical emergencies. Inquire about the details: What is included in the base cost? How are dietary needs, especially common concerns like diabetes or heart health, managed? How do they support residents’ spiritual life or personal hobbies? For families in our region, it’s also wise to ask about their policies for severe weather, ensuring there are solid plans for safety during Nebraska’s storms or winter blizzards.

Finally, involve your loved one in the decision as much as possible. Their comfort and sense of autonomy are paramount. This journey is about honoring their life by ensuring their safety, dignity, and happiness in the years to come. Remember, you are not alone. Reach out to local resources like the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services for licensing information, or talk to friends and neighbors who have navigated this path. Finding the right long term care is about building a new support system, one that complements the enduring love and care your family provides.
